Dark Wood Floor Installation Questions
What types of dark wood floors are available for installation? Popular options include oak, walnut, and mahogany, each offering distinct color and grain patterns to suit different styles.
Is dark wood flooring suitable for high-traffic areas? Yes, with proper finishing and maintenance, dark hardwood floors can withstand daily wear in busy spaces.
What should property owners consider before installing dark wood floors? It is important to evaluate the existing lighting, room size, and overall decor to ensure the dark finish complements the space.
Can dark wood floors be installed over existing flooring? In many cases, dark hardwood can be installed over existing surfaces, but a professional assessment is recommended to determine compatibility.
